Default West Va Panini Run on Sat

UPDATE Meet at the Sheetz at 9:30

Its the corner of 15 and 55 in Haymarket, Take 66 West to Exit 40, left on 15, the Sheetz is 1/4 mile on the left

Be ready to drive out at 10:00 AM.

Matt in VA originally put a feeler out for a drive I am just taking over...

The weather on Sat looks really good for a drive.

I have a route similar to the one we did in August, just goes further west a bit. And leads to a fantastic little place for Panini sandwichs for lunch.

This is a bit of a drive, appx 150 miles from DC (ONE WAY) but well worth it.

At least 4 mountain ranges crossed and 100 miles of back roads with many twisties and scenic areas.

Plan on leaving ~ no later than 10:00 AM from the Sheetz and getting back around 4:00

This will be a touring type of pace, while rural there may be some leaf peepers in the way. Also many DEER to keep an eye out for.

Can I get a show of hands of interested folks?
